Cheese Press
Cheese press is a device used in the cheese-making process to apply pressure to the curds, expel whey, and shape the cheese into a desired form. It is an essential tool for achieving the proper texture, consistency, and shape of various types of cheeses. The cheese press helps remove excess moisture from the curds, compact them, and create a solid structure.

Technical Specifications

- Design: Includes base, follower (plate/weight), and pressure adjustment mechanism; available in stainless steel, plastic, or wood. - Pressure Control: Manual or mechanical regulation of pressure to suit various cheese types. - Whey Drainage: Built-in drainage system for efficient whey removal. - Molds: Equipped with removable or integrated molds for shaping cheese. - Pressing Time: Adjustable pressing duration to accommodate different cheese processes. - Cleaning: Easy-to-clean surfaces with removable or hygienic components. - Size & Capacity: Available in various sizes to suit small-scale to industrial production.
